"dakinhar" meaning in Maltese

See dakinhar in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Adverb

IPA: /da.kɪˈnaːr/
Etymology: From dak in-nhar (“that day”). The gemination caused by the definite article was reduced when h was still a consonant. Outside the lexicalised adverb it was later restored, such that both are now pronounced differently. Compare the same in nofsinhar. Head templates: {{mt-adverb}} dakinhar
  1. (on) that day
    Sense id: en-dakinhar-mt-adv--e9x0et9
  2. back then, at that time Synonyms: dak iż-żmien
